Question
graph the image of △tuv after a rotation 90° counterclockwise around the origin.
Step1: Recall rotation rule
The rule for a 90 - degree counter - clockwise rotation around the origin is $(x,y)\to(-y,x)$.
Step2: Identify original coordinates
Let's assume the coordinates of the vertices of $\triangle TUV$ are $T(x_1,y_1)$, $U(x_2,y_2)$ and $V(x_3,y_3)$.
Step3: Apply rotation rule
The new coordinates of $T$ will be $T'(-y_1,x_1)$, of $U$ will be $U'(-y_2,x_2)$ and of $V$ will be $V'(-y_3,x_3)$.
Step4: Plot new points
Plot the points $T'$, $U'$ and $V'$ on the coordinate - plane and connect them to form the rotated triangle.
